I wrote about Hannah Kennedy's sunset at the beach photograph. The photo is at
the beach with three different groups throughout in different depths of field.
The colors make the picture stand out. The colors are dark blue and light
yellow.
The sunset colors are gorgeous . The contrast in the colors are very good (dark blue vs. light yellow). The different depths of field help the person viewing the photo, see the entire picture. You
can see the people in the background. This shows distance. There is also balance
with the different groups of people at the beach. The negative space in the
beach have the darker colors. I believe this is really original and creative.
The colors from a far makes the photo standout. The subject of the beach is very
compelling. It makes you want to look at all the details.
The feeling the photograph gives off is very calm and peaceful because the sun is setting right before it turns night. The picture is very soft with the help of the colors. You can see the detail in
the grooves in the sand. The sky matches the sand because of the reflection. You
can also see a little bit of the water. Just nit picking, maybe getting a little
closer to the first group (closest group)in the foreground to improve the photo.
I really like the three different groups throughout the photo. Overall I really
enjoyed the photo!
